Tamilaga Vetri Kazagham (TVK) chief has been named the CM candidate by the party for 2026 Assembly elections in Tamil Nadu. Following his election, Vijay spoke to his party cadre.

Thalapathy ruled out any alliance with the BJP. He said BJP was into divisive politics and hence his party will not form any alliance with them. The BJP can have its way anywhere, but not in Tamil Nadu, said the actor-politician.

He reiterated that there would be no alliance with a party that looks to divide than unite people.

Recently, when asked about an alliance with TVK, Union Home Minister Amit Shah stated that elections were long time away and they will decide on it. He kept the options open for fledgling TVK party. However, now Vijay has said point blank that there were would be no alliance, ending anticipation.

It has to be noted that Thalapathy Vijay who ruled Tamil box office hasn’t been able to create mass euphoria among Tamil people through his political entry. Vijay has taken the services of political strategist and Jan Suraaj head Prashant Kishor for political advise.

But analysts feel the decision might prove costly for Vijay in the long run as the BJP has set its focus on penetrating Tamil Nadu vote bank.

If one looks at the BJP strategy, it has been showering development programmes on states where it has come to power either on its own strength or in alliance.

One such example is of neighbouring Andhra Pradesh where the BJP went to polls with regional parties TDP and Jana Sena.




In Tamil Nadu, BJP will be aligning with AIADMK. If there is an anti-incumbency vote and the alliance comes to power, Vijay would be relegated to back seat in Tamil Nadu. Political analysts feel Vijay could have bargained for the CM seat by forming a triangular alliance like in AP.
